Google Cloud Functions

blur

Learn Path Description

This path is meant to get you started using Google Cloud Functions and will get you started with serverless compute on GCP.

Skills You Will Gain

Courses In This Learning Path

blur
icon

Total Duration

2.27 hours

icon

Level

Beginner

icon

Learn Type

Certifications

Google Cloud Functions: Getting Started

Developers are looking to create serverless microservices that can be used to create new content, scale quickly, scale easily, and deliver features to their users more quickly. This course, Google Cloud Functions Getting Started, will teach you how to create high-quality microservices that enhance your website or app's user experience. You will first set up a Google Cloud project. Next, you'll install the gcloud command-line tools and then set up Google Cloud Functions locally. Next, you'll explore the various events that your functions can respond, including storage, PubSub and HTTP triggers. The final step is to deploy the functions and learn how they integrate seamlessly into the Google Cloud Platform. This course will give you a solid understanding about Google Cloud Functions and will enable you to create and deploy microservices that automatically scale with users.

blur
icon

Total Duration

4.51 hours

icon

Level

Intermediate

icon

Learn Type

Certifications

Google Cloud Functions Fundamentals

Developers are looking to create serverless microservices that can be used to create new content, reduce maintenance, scale easily and deliver new features to their users more quickly. This course, Google Cloud Functions Foundations, will help you improve your serverless skills and create high-quality Microservices to enhance your website or app's user experience. You will first learn how to create unique functions that can interact with other Google Cloud services like Cloud Vision and Cloud Datastore. You will also learn advanced concepts like the function's file structure, idempotent design, and how to work through memory and timeout problems. You will also learn how to log errors and set up monitoring so that you can monitor your functions once they are live. This course will give you a deep understanding of Google Cloud Functions, which will enable you to create unique experiences that your customers will love.

blur
icon

Total Duration

2.33 hours

icon

Level

Intermediate

icon

Learn Type

Certifications

Firebase Functions: Fundamentals

Firebase Functions allows you to automatically run backend code when Firebase features or HTTPS requests trigger them. This course, Firebase Functions Fundamentals, will teach you how to use Cloud Functions with Firebase. You will first learn about cloud functions. Next, you'll learn how to create callable function and how to call them directly. You will also learn how to trigger Firebase functions using different Firebase services, such as Cloud Firestore, Real time Database, Authentication, and others. This course will give you a solid understanding of Firebase functions, and help you create complex apps.

blur